Welcome to Advanced Band Class 3, guided by Melissa McCabe! In this session, dancers will explore dynamic flexibility, combining controlled mobility with targeted strengthening exercises to enhance alignment, glute and leg strength, and prepare dancers effectively for both allegro and adagio.
Tips:
Remind dancers during Dynamic Warm Up Stretch that they should work within the range that they can control, prioritising pelvic alignment rather than extreme flexibility.
Highlight the importance of rib alignment and core engagement throughout the class to ensure controlled flexibility and safe execution of movements.
In exercises focusing on strength for allegro, remind dancers that glute activation directly translates to stronger, safer jumps.
